Siete Leguas Blanco is an additive-free 100% Blue Weber agave blanco produced at the family owned Siete Leguas distillery in Atotonilco el Alto, NOM 1120, founded in 1952 and named after Pancho Villa's horse. The house is a classic dual method operation, running a mule drawn stone tahona at El Centenario alongside a roller mill at La Vencedora, then blending the two, and it is remembered as the distillery that produced the original Patrón before that brand built its own site in 2002.
Wild yeast fermentation in wooden vats and copper pot distillation feed a layered blanco. The nose is floral and fine, with sweet dried apricot and a hint of spice; the palate brings cooked agave in harmony with green herbs, citrus, dried stone fruit and blossom honey. Bottled at 40% and additive-free, it is a balanced, structured highland blanco that long served as a benchmark for the category.
